Ok so I did some checking and it is pressurisation that is causing the door issue. When I first load the cold and dark I see the cabin climb dial is off the roof (climb), as I switch on bat and stby power I see the the outflow valve is closed or closing and the cabin pressure is rising quickly which causes the doors to plug shut. To remedy it I can either wait for the auto system to get with it and reopen the outflow valve or I can set it to manual and open it manually. After it is open I switch back to auto (don't want a Helios repeat) and it lights up "Auto fail", it gets over that though while I and going through preflight. The weird and stupid part is there should be nothing pressurising the cabin, I have nothing connected and I suspect it is some sort of weather deal when the plane is initializing. For the moment I created a cold and dark panel state with the door open already, or I go through that process everytime.
